DURHAM, Justice:
This is an action to recover damages for the loss of the plaintiffs' farm crop and planting and soil preparation costs for 1977. The plaintiffs' claim is premised on the defendant's alleged contractual obligation to provide the plaintiffs with real "three-phase" electric power by 1977.
